Seatrade International logo

Seatrade International

Food and Beverage ManufacturingMassachusetts, United States11-50 Employees

Seatrade International, founded in 1981, operates in the food and beverage manufacturing sector with a focus on seafood processing and distribution. It is a prominent player in the U.S. scallop market and also processes under-utilized species such as dogfish, monkfish, and skatewings, in addition to distributing cold-water lobster products. It sources products globally and supplies fresh, frozen, and live seafood to broadliners, wholesalers, and supermarkets across North America, Europe, and Asia, serving restaurants, institutional foodservice, and home consumers.

Based in New Bedford, Massachusetts, the company maintains a new state-of-the-art production facility in Lakeville and operates three facilities to ensure a reliable supply under strict quality control and traceability. It emphasizes a safe production environment and a reduced carbon footprint, with support from an experienced sales and customer service team that provides personal service. Seatrade operates as a subsidiary of East Coast Seafood Group, a Boston-area company network whose members trade live lobster, lobster products, scallops, and finfish across the United States, Europe, and Asia.
